International Day for the Prevention of Violent Extremism as and when Conducive to Terrorism 2024

Every year on February 12th, people celebrate the International Day for the Prevention of Violent Extremism as and when Conducive to Terrorism (PVE Day). The main purpose of the day is to raise awareness about the dangers of violent extremism and promote international cooperation in tackling this complex issue.

PVE Day marks the urgency of addressing the root causes of violent extremism. The day aims to highlight the need for comprehensive strategies that go beyond security measures and focus on:

  • Promoting social inclusion and addressing grievances.
  • Providing educational and economic opportunities.
  • Countering online radicalization and hate speech.
  • Empowering communities to build resilience and foster peace.

PVE Day, Theme 2024

The theme 2024: “Living Together: Fostering Community Resilience to Prevent Violent Extremism as and when Conducive to Terrorism” The theme highlights the collective responsibility to make inclusive and resilient societies where violent extremism finds no ground.
